About Banks

Banks sits in the upper Tualatin Valley at an elevation of approximately 220 feet, where the agricultural valley floor gives way to the heavily timbered Coast Range foothills. The terrain around Banks transitions quickly from gently rolling farmland to moderate and steep forested slopes, and many rural properties in the area include a mix of open ground and timber. Soils in the Banks area include Laurelwood silt loam on the ridge tops, Kinton silt loam on the side slopes, and Melbourne silty clay loam in the timbered foothills. The heavier clay soils on sloped parcels require careful assessment for stability and drainage, particularly after timber has been harvested and root systems begin to decay. Banks is a small city with limited planning resources, and most of the properties we work on in the Banks area are in unincorporated Washington County, falling under Washington County Land Use and Transportation for permits. The rural properties surrounding Banks are predominantly zoned for timber, farm, or rural residential use, and manufactured homes are a common housing type on these parcels. Nearly all properties outside the small Banks sewer service area require individual septic systems, and the hilly terrain and clay soils can make septic design and installation more complex. Banks is known as a trailhead for the Banks-Vernonia State Trail, a 21-mile paved rail-trail that follows a former railroad line through the Coast Range to the timber town of Vernonia. Highway 26, the primary corridor between Portland and the Oregon Coast, passes through the Banks area. The Banks School District serves the local community.
